10.22059/ijmge.2015.54361 Abstract This paper tries to determine an optimum condition for the flotation operation of the Alborz-Sharghi coal washing plant. For this purpose, a series of comprehensive experiments have been conducted on representative samples from feed of the flotation system of the plant.

Sadeghi et al. [14] have investigated an image processing method applied to model the pyrite oxidation in the wastes of the AlborzSharghi coal washing plant, NE of Iran. Shokri et al. [18] have presented a statistical model for predicting pyrite oxidation in a coal waste pile at AlborzSharghi, Iran.
